Oil prices extend losses as Hormuz reopening hopes ease supply fears
Brent crude fell 0.5% to $87.43 a barrel Oil prices extended their decline on Thursday as hopes of renewed Middle East diplomacy raised expectations that the Strait of Hormuz could reopen, easing concerns over prolonged supply disruptions.Brent crude fell 0.5 per cent to $87.43 a barrel, heading for a fourth straight session of losses, while…
